Manchester United Transfer Rumors: Mats Hummels Is a Perfect Deadline Day Target
Mats Hummels of Borussia Dortmund would be a perfect young star for Manchester United to target on transfer deadline day as the club looks to improve their defensive quality.
Hummels is one of the best centre-backs in the world and is someone who United manager Sir Alex Ferguson could mold into a top player in the Premier League.
The Red Devils were interested in signing the German defender earlier in the season and would be wise to make a bold move to secure the transfer of Hummels on deadline day.

With top defenders Nemanja Vidic and Rio Ferdinand battling injuries this season, and Vidic now out for the season, United need another quality centre-back if they are to repeat as Premier League champions.
Jonny Evans, Chris Smalling and Phil Jones are not of the same quality as Vidic and Ferdinand, but Hummels is.
The German star is a tremendous defender with his strength, size and football intelligence. He is also composed with the ball on his feet and is able to find midfielders with spot-on passes to start the attack towards goal.
Hummels is only 23 years old and has lots of experience, which included many matches for Dortmund and 12 caps for the German team at the international level.
He would have little trouble fitting in with United and his strong defensive playing style is well-suited for the Premier League.
With Dortmund fighting for the Bundesliga title and Hummels wanting to impress the German coaches ahead of the European Championships this summer, a transfer to Old Trafford is unlikely, but it would be a smart move for Ferguson going forward.
Even though his price may be inflated this window, he would be a great addition to a United defense that needs to improve with Ferdinand and Vidic missing long stretches of time due to injury.
